What Should You Consider When Choosing the Best String Trimmer?

When choosing the best string trimmer, several important factors should be considered to ensure you select the right one for your needs.

  • Power Source: The primary power sources for string trimmers are gas, electric (corded), and battery-operated. Gas trimmers are typically more powerful and suitable for larger areas, while electric models are quieter and easier to maintain. Battery-operated trimmers offer portability but may have limited runtime depending on battery capacity.
  • Cutting Width: The cutting width of a trimmer refers to the diameter of the area it can cut with each pass. A wider cutting width can help you complete your tasks more quickly, but it may also make the trimmer heavier and harder to maneuver in tight spaces. For smaller yards or detailed work, a narrower cutting width may be more appropriate.
  • Weight and Balance: The weight of the trimmer can significantly affect user comfort, especially during extended use. A well-balanced trimmer can reduce strain on your arms and back, making it easier to handle. It’s essential to choose a trimmer that you can comfortably lift and maneuver without excessive fatigue.
  • Line Feed Type: String trimmers utilize different line feed mechanisms, such as bump feed, automatic feed, or fixed line. Bump feed allows you to tap the trimmer on the ground to release more line, while automatic feed advances the line as needed. Fixed line models use pre-cut lengths of line, which can be less convenient but may offer consistent performance.
  • Build Quality: The durability of a string trimmer is influenced by the materials used in its construction. High-quality trimmers often have sturdy components that can withstand regular use and exposure to outdoor elements. Investing in a trimmer with a solid build can save you money on repairs and replacements in the long run.
  • Noise Level: Noise can be a significant factor, especially in residential areas or if you have close neighbors. Gas-powered trimmers tend to be louder than electric ones, which are generally quieter and can be more considerate for residential use. If noise is a concern, looking for models specifically designed to minimize sound can be beneficial.
  • Price and Warranty: The cost of string trimmers can vary widely based on features, brand, and power source. It’s crucial to set a budget that reflects your needs while considering the warranty offered by the manufacturer. A good warranty can provide peace of mind and protection against defects or issues that may arise after purchase.

What Are the Main Types of String Trimmers Available?

The main types of string trimmers available are:

  • Gas String Trimmers: These trimmers are powered by gasoline engines, offering high power and extended run time, making them suitable for larger yards or professional use.
  • Electric String Trimmers: Available in corded and cordless models, electric trimmers are lighter and quieter than gas models, ideal for smaller yards or residential use.
  • Battery-Powered String Trimmers: These are a subset of electric trimmers that rely on rechargeable batteries, providing freedom from cords and the power of gas models, though typically with limited runtime.
  • Robotic String Trimmers: Automated trimmers that can mow lawns without human intervention, they are programmed to navigate the yard and are gaining popularity for their convenience.

Gas String Trimmers: These trimmers are ideal for heavy-duty tasks and can handle thicker grass and tougher terrains. They typically have longer run times and are not limited by cord length, making them suitable for larger properties. However, they tend to be heavier, require regular maintenance, and produce emissions, which may not be suitable for all users.

Electric String Trimmers: Electric models are quieter and easier to start than gas models, making them user-friendly. Corded versions are perfect for small to medium-sized yards and provide unlimited run time as long as they’re plugged in. Cordless models offer portability and ease of use but have limitations in terms of battery life and power compared to their gas counterparts.

Battery-Powered String Trimmers: These trimmers combine the convenience of electric models with the freedom from cords, allowing users to maneuver easily around obstacles. They are typically lightweight and quieter, making them an attractive option for residential use. However, the battery life can be a concern for larger tasks, requiring users to manage charging times effectively.

Robotic String Trimmers: Robotic models represent the latest technology in lawn care, operating autonomously to trim grass to a preset height. They are programmed with boundary settings and can navigate around obstacles, providing a hands-free solution for lawn maintenance. While they offer convenience and time savings, their initial cost can be higher, and they may not be suitable for all terrains or lawn types.

How Do Electric String Trimmers Compare to Gas Models?

Feature Electric Trimmers Gas Trimmers
Power Source Powered by electricity, either corded or battery-operated. Powered by gasoline, offering more power for heavy-duty tasks.
Weight Generally lighter, making them easier to maneuver. Typically heavier due to the engine and fuel tank.
Noise Level Quieter operation, suitable for residential areas. Can be quite loud, potentially disturbing neighbors.
Maintenance Lower maintenance; less frequent repairs needed. Higher maintenance; requires regular oil changes and tune-ups.
Price Range Generally lower initial cost, prices vary based on battery life and brand. Typically higher initial cost, prices vary based on power and brand.
Run Time Limited by battery life; usually 30 to 60 minutes depending on usage. Unlimited run time as long as fuel is available.
Power Output Typically ranges from 12 to 40 volts for electric models. Power measured in cc, usually ranges from 25cc to 50cc for gas models.
Environmental Impact Lower emissions; more environmentally friendly. Higher emissions due to gasoline combustion; less eco-friendly.
Usability Best for light to medium-duty tasks and small yards. Better for heavy-duty tasks and larger areas with tougher vegetation.

What Key Features Define a High-Quality String Trimmer?

The key features that define a high-quality string trimmer include:

  • Power Source: The power source of a string trimmer can be gas, electric, or battery-operated. Gas trimmers generally provide more power and are suitable for heavy-duty tasks, while electric and battery models are quieter, lighter, and more environmentally friendly, making them ideal for residential use.
  • Cutting Width: The cutting width of a string trimmer determines how much area can be covered in one pass. A larger cutting width (typically between 12 to 18 inches) allows for quicker trimming, making it efficient for larger yards, while a smaller width can offer more precision in tight spaces.
  • Weight and Balance: The weight and balance of a string trimmer significantly affect user comfort and ease of use. A well-balanced trimmer reduces fatigue during prolonged use, while a lightweight design makes it easier to maneuver, especially for users who may struggle with heavier equipment.
  • Line Feed Mechanism: String trimmers typically come with either manual or automatic line feed mechanisms. Automatic feed systems provide a consistent line length without user intervention, while manual systems allow for greater control over line length but require more effort to adjust.
  • Durability and Build Quality: The materials used in the construction of a string trimmer influence its overall durability and lifespan. High-quality trimmers often feature robust materials such as aluminum or reinforced plastic, ensuring they can withstand the rigors of outdoor use and resist wear over time.
  • Adjustability and Ergonomics: Features such as adjustable handles, telescoping shafts, and ergonomic grips enhance user comfort and control. These adjustments allow for a customized fit, which can help reduce strain during operation and improve overall trimming efficiency.
  • Noise Level: The noise level of a string trimmer is an important consideration, especially in residential areas. Electric and battery-operated trimmers tend to be quieter than gas models, making them more suitable for use in noise-sensitive environments while still maintaining effective performance.
  • Accessories and Versatility: Some string trimmers come with additional attachments or accessories, such as brush cutter blades or hedge trimmer heads, increasing their versatility. This allows users to perform multiple tasks with a single tool, making it a more cost-effective and efficient choice for yard maintenance.

What Should You Know About Warranty and Customer Support?

Understanding warranty and customer support is crucial when purchasing the best string trimmer.

  • Warranty Period: The warranty period typically outlines how long the manufacturer guarantees the product against defects in materials and workmanship.
  • Coverage Details: This includes specific components covered under the warranty and whether it includes repairs, replacements, or refunds.
  • Customer Support Availability: Knowing the hours and methods of contacting customer support can significantly impact your experience if issues arise.
  • Return Policy: A clear return policy informs you of the conditions under which you can return the product if it does not meet your expectations.
  • Service Centers: Understanding the location and accessibility of authorized service centers can help in resolving issues efficiently.

The warranty period is essential because it defines the timeframe during which you can seek repairs or replacements without additional cost. Most string trimmers come with a warranty ranging from one to three years, but premium brands may offer extended warranties to enhance consumer confidence.

Coverage details specify which parts and types of damage are included under the warranty. For example, some warranties may cover the motor and drive system but exclude consumable items like the cutting line or battery, so it’s important to read the fine print.

Customer support availability can vary greatly among brands. Look for manufacturers that offer multiple contact methods, such as phone, email, or live chat, along with their operational hours, because timely assistance can be crucial if you encounter problems.

A clear return policy is vital as it outlines your rights as a consumer regarding product dissatisfaction. This policy typically includes time limits for returns and the condition in which the product must be to qualify for a refund or exchange.

Service centers are important for users who may need repairs or maintenance outside of the warranty. Knowing where to find these centers, how to contact them, and what services they offer will facilitate smoother resolutions to any issues that may arise with your string trimmer.

What Regular Maintenance Tasks Should You Perform?

Regular maintenance tasks for a string trimmer are essential to ensure its longevity and optimal performance.

  • Clean the Air Filter: Regularly cleaning or replacing the air filter helps maintain engine performance by ensuring a steady flow of clean air. A clogged air filter can reduce power and increase fuel consumption, making it crucial to check it frequently.
  • Inspect and Replace the Spark Plug: The spark plug should be checked for wear and carbon build-up, as a faulty spark plug can lead to starting issues and poor engine performance. Replacing it annually or as needed can help in achieving reliable ignition and smooth operation.
  • Sharpen the Cutting Blades or Line: Keeping the cutting blades or string sharp is vital for effective trimming. Dull edges can lead to jagged cuts and increased strain on the engine, so it’s beneficial to sharpen them regularly or replace the line when it becomes worn.
  • Check Fuel System Components: Inspecting the fuel lines, filter, and tank for leaks or clogs ensures proper fuel flow to the engine. Using fresh fuel and maintaining the fuel system can prevent starting problems and enhance performance.
  • Inspect the Trimmer Head: The trimmer head should be checked for damage and debris build-up, which can affect its performance. Regular cleaning and timely replacement of worn-out parts can extend the life of your trimmer head and ensure efficient cutting.
  • Examine the Starter Mechanism: The starter cord and mechanism should be inspected for wear and smooth operation. Any signs of fraying or difficulty in starting could indicate a need for repair; maintaining this component can prevent starting issues and enhance reliability.
  • Lubricate Moving Parts: Applying lubricant to moving parts reduces friction and wear, contributing to smoother operation. Regular lubrication of pivot points and other moving components can prolong the life of your string trimmer.
